Safety
Kids bunk beds that have stairways provide more security than a ladder for older children, especially. They can also come with built in storage to eliminate clutter, and allow children to climb up and back down without adult assistance. Stairs are also more stable and safer than ladders that can sway or fall, potentially injury to children.
Although bunk beds for children with stairs are generally safe, it is important that you follow all the safety precautions. For instance children should be urged to use only the ladder to get onto the top bunk and never sit on chairs or other furniture items in order to reach the bed. It is also an excellent idea to have children put away their toys and other things after they have finished playing. This will lower the risk of accidents.
A lot of bunk beds for kids with stairs are equipped with guard rails at the sides and the ends of the mattress foundation, which help prevent children from falling out of the bed or being trapped between the bunk and the wall. The beds are also built with a sturdy slat system and are constructed of grained wood. They are also tested by independent laboratories to ensure they meet national safety standards.
If you are considering purchasing a bunk bed with stairs for your children it is crucial to select one with guard rails that are at least 3.5 inches wide to avoid strangulation. In addition, it is an ideal idea to put the bed away from windows and ceiling fans that could create dangers.
Another important safety tip is to regularly inspect the bunk bed for broken or loose parts. If any other accessories are added, for example, a playhouse or slide, they should be properly mounted and secured to the bunk bed. Parents should make sure to check regularly that all connectors and screws are in good condition and not wobbling. If a screw or connect is loose, it should be tightened immediately.
